FDA Compliance is an integral half of manufacture within the food, drug and cosmetic industries, to make sure that the general public isn't place at risk from consuming or using any new or sustained products on the market. There are many aspects of compliance together with Sensible Manufacturing Practise, packaging and labelling, selling and other factors. As center of the Department of Health and Human Services, the FDA is enabled to issue laws and enforce these on the ninety five,000 regulated businesses under its authority. The FDA ensures regulatory compliance across a number of product including food (excluding pork and poultry), medicine, medical devices, blood, biological products, and cosmetics. The sole aim of FDA compliance is to safeguard the health of shoppers and maintain the standard of products. Only when organizations integrate FDA Compliance into their operating lifestyle instead of viewing it as merely another regulation, can the authorities, businesses and customers be happy. There are 2 major impacts that failure to comply will have; public injury and company prosecution. When a product is contaminated, packaged incorrectly or fails to satisfy any of the laws, shoppers are place at risk, their health may suffer and in extreme cases, this may result in death. If the ingredients listed on packaging is wrong, allergies are potential, just as when the strengths are confused accidental overdoses might occur. For firms who fail to suits the FDA, there are several possible outcomes, all of which are harmful to the longevity of the business. Product recall and seizure not solely damages profits, but it also damages the stock of the business, creating it less engaging to trade with and buyers are less likely to buy merchandise off them. For serious defiance of FDA compliance, a business can be fined huge sums of cash and individual workers can be subject to criminal prosecution and jail sentences if they're found to own put human life at risk. The FDA publishes a listing of companies and individuals who have been barred from operating in any of the industries coated by the FDA due to criminal and life threatening activities. This alone ought to place compliance at the top of an organisation's agenda. Whilst several businesses see compliance and regulation as a hindrance to their productivity and effectiveness, the FDA is working to form its laws easier for manufacturers to stick to and fewer sort of a drain on resources and employee focus. Several of the laws are open ended and general that allows managers to implement them to suit their individual business. Smaller organisations will need a totally different approach than larger firms and therefore the open-endedness reflects this. FDA Compliance covers record keeping, personnel qualifications, sanitation, cleanliness, equipment verification, process validation and criticism handling. All of these features work towards public satisfaction and safety, keeping the quality of food, medicine, cosmetics and alternative products underneath FDA regulation high, while allowing businesses to work in ways in which that suit them. There would be no purpose in implementing all of these laws if productivity was hampered and analysis stifled. These rules still enable for advances in science and technology, however they put public safety as their top priority.
